What does mx or mx = b mean in math pls explain from like your knowledge

1 Answer

5 votes

Explanation:

In the equation y = mx + b for a straight line, the number m is called the slope of the line. In the equation y = mx + b for a straight line, the. number b is called the y-intercept of the line.
